England
Jordan Pickford Odd call to chest Fabian Delph’s backpass. Unlucky with Andrej Kramaric’s goal 6
Kyle Walker Enterprising when he attacked from right-back. But he could have been closer to Kramaric 6
Joe Gomez A composed presence at the back. His long throw led to England’s equalising goal 7
John Stones Will be annoyed at how Kramaric fooled him for the opener. Had a role in Jesse Lingard’s leveller 5
Ben Chilwell Exposed when Croatia scored. Disappointing set-pieces until his free-kick led to Harry Kane’s winner 6
Eric Dier Coped with Luka Modric. One late error almost costly. Unlucky when hit by Kramaric’s shot 6
Fabian Delph Recovered after nearly gifting early goal. But does Harry Winks offer more in possession? 6
Ross Barkley Booked after reacting to being dispossessed with Modric foul. Replaced by the more effective Dele Alli 5
Raheem Sterling While his speed caused problems, he lacked conviction in front of goal. Not clinical enough 6
Harry Kane Captain was involved in the equaliser and produced an instinctive finish for the winner 8
Marcus Rashford Offered thrust on the left. One brilliant run from own half deserved better finish from Sterling 6
Subs Dele Alli (for Barkley 63) 7; Jesse Lingard (for Delph 73) 7; Jadon Sancho (for Rashford 73) 6
Croatia
Lovre Kalinic Decisive goalkeeping denied Kane and Sterling several times. Let down by his defence for goals 7
Sime Vrsaljko Had his hands full with Rashford before departing with an injury in the first half 6
Dejan Lovren The centre-back was key part of a defence that failed to deal with England’s late aerial assault 4
Domagoj Vida Almost sealed it for Croatia with a thumping header. Like Lovren he was poor in the final 15 minutes 4
Tin Jedvaj Unsettled by pace of Sterling. Cleared Kane shot off the line. Unconvincing after swapping flanks 5
Luka Modric Worked hard but Croatia’s talisman was not as influential as he was in the summer at World Cup 6
Marcelo Brozovic Did not offer as much subtlety as Ivan Rakitic and spurned a late chance. Booked for dissent 5
Ante Rebic Lifted over an early opportunity and sliced a cross into the stands. Substituted at half-time 5
Nikola Vlasic Largely anonymous until he wriggled through on the right to set up Kramaric’s goal. 6
Ivan Perisic The forward who got the better of Walker at the World Cup improved in the second half 6
Andrej Kramaric His excellent footwork beat Stones and earned space for a shot that looped beyond Pickford 7
Subs Antonio Milic (for Vrsaljko 26) 6; Josip Brekalo (for Rebic ht) 6; Marko Rog (for Vlasic 79) 6
